10 Language-to-English DictionariesDevolution
The transfer or delegation of power to a lower level, especially by central government to local or regional administration.
Devotee
A person who is very interested in and enthusiastic about someone or something.
Devotion
Love, loyalty, or enthusiasm for a person, activity, or cause.
Devout
Having or showing deep religious feeling or commitment.
Dexterity
Skill in performing tasks, especially with the hands.
Diacritic
A mark added to a letter to indicate a different pronunciation, sound value, or tone.
Diaspora
The dispersion or spread of any people from their original homeland.
Diatom
A single-celled alga which has a cell wall of silica, characteristic of both fresh and marine plankton.
Diatomaceous
Consisting of, containing, or relating to the fossilized remains of diatoms, particularly in the form of a soft, chalky rock.
Dictionary
A book or electronic resource that lists the words of a language in alphabetical order and gives their meaning, or gives the equivalent words in a different language.
Diegesis
The total world of a story, including characters, places, and events, experienced or experienced as existing within the context of the narrative.
Diesel
An internal combustion engine in which heat ignited by the compression of air is used to raise the temperature of the fuel to the point of ignition, used especially as a heavy-duty power source.
